The very first widescreen transfer of "Star Wars" on video at all came in the form of this Standard Play (CAV) "Special Collection" edition from Fox in Japan. Using the same print master as the previous editions (the same print flaws are present), the 2.39:1 image is shifted up on the screen to make room for the subtitles at the bottom. No supplements but how cool was it to have a widescreen version in standard play? Those Japanese got all the good stuff.

The artwork is the same on the back as all previous editions, and the front is essentially the same except reduced to produce a white border. Each disc is stored in it's own custom sleeve which lists the chapter stops for that disc.
